黑狐家游戏

数据湖和数据仓库的区别,数据湖与数据仓库,深入解析两者的区别与应用场景

欧气 0 0

本文目录导读:

  1. 数据湖与数据仓库的区别
  2. 数据湖与数据仓库的应用场景

随着大数据时代的到来,数据湖和数据仓库作为数据管理的重要工具,越来越受到企业的关注,两者在数据存储、处理、分析等方面存在诸多区别,企业在选择时可能会感到困惑,本文将从数据湖和数据仓库的区别入手,深入探讨两者的应用场景,帮助读者更好地理解并选择适合自己的数据管理工具。

数据湖与数据仓库的区别

1、数据类型

数据湖和数据仓库的区别,数据湖与数据仓库,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

数据湖支持各种类型的数据,包括结构化、半结构化和非结构化数据,而数据仓库主要针对结构化数据,如关系型数据库中的表格。

2、数据存储

数据湖采用分布式存储技术,如Hadoop的HDFS,将数据存储在大量廉价的磁盘上,数据仓库则依赖于传统的存储技术,如关系型数据库、NOSQL数据库等。

3、数据处理

数据湖通常采用批处理方式,处理大量数据,数据仓库则支持实时处理和查询,以满足用户对数据及时性的需求。

4、数据结构

数据湖中的数据通常没有固定的格式,用户可以根据实际需求进行定制,数据仓库中的数据结构较为固定,如表格、索引等。

5、数据访问

数据湖提供丰富的数据访问接口,如Hadoop的MapReduce、Spark等,数据仓库则主要提供SQL查询接口。

数据湖和数据仓库的区别,数据湖与数据仓库,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

6、数据安全

数据湖的安全性相对较低,主要依赖于Hadoop等底层存储系统的安全机制,数据仓库的安全性较高,具备完善的安全管理体系。

7、成本

数据湖采用分布式存储技术,成本较低,数据仓库则依赖于传统的存储技术,成本相对较高。

数据湖与数据仓库的应用场景

1、数据湖

(1)大数据分析:数据湖能够存储各种类型的数据,适用于大规模数据挖掘和分析。

(2)数据挖掘:数据湖中的非结构化数据为数据挖掘提供了丰富的资源。

(3)数据治理:数据湖有助于企业进行数据治理,提高数据质量。

2、数据仓库

数据湖和数据仓库的区别,数据湖与数据仓库,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

(1)企业级应用:数据仓库适用于企业级应用,如CRM、ERP等,满足企业对数据实时性和准确性的需求。

(2)决策支持:数据仓库中的数据结构化、标准化,便于企业进行决策支持。

(3)数据集成:数据仓库能够整合来自各个系统的数据,提高数据利用率。

数据湖和数据仓库各有优劣,企业在选择时应根据自身需求和应用场景进行判断,以下是一些建议:

1、若企业需要处理大量非结构化数据,且对数据实时性要求不高,可选择数据湖。

2、若企业需要实时处理结构化数据,且对数据安全性要求较高,可选择数据仓库。

3、对于数据量较大、类型多样的企业,可考虑采用数据湖和数据仓库相结合的方式,以充分发挥两者的优势。

数据湖与数据仓库在数据管理领域扮演着重要角色,了解两者的区别与应用场景,有助于企业选择合适的数据管理工具,提高数据价值。

标签: #数据湖和数据仓库哪个好

黑狐家游戏
  • 评论列表

留言评论